Calculating Your Bonus
Betfair typically offers a matched deposit bonus for new Australian players. For this example, assume the promotion is a 100% match up to A$200 with a wagering requirement of 20x the bonus amount on eligible games. Here is the detailed calculation using real numbers and formulas.
Step 1 – Determine the bonus amount.
If you deposit A$150, the bonus is 100% of that, capped at A$200. So you receive A$150 as bonus. If you deposit A$250, you receive the maximum A$200.
Step 2 – Calculate the total wagering requirement.
Formula: Wagering Requirement = Bonus × Wagering Multiplier
Example (deposit A$150): A$150 × 20 = A$3,000 must be wagered before any withdrawal of bonus funds.
Step 3 – Consider game contribution rates.
Not all bets count 100%. Typically, slots contribute 100%, table games contribute 10%, and live dealer games contribute 5%. Let us assume you play only slots (100% contribution). Then the effective wagering requirement remains A$3,000.
Step 4 – Estimate the expected loss during wagering.
If the average house edge of the slots you play is 3%, the expected loss is: Expected Loss = Wagering Requirement × House Edge
= A$3,000 × 0.03 = A$90. That means out of your A$150 deposit plus A$150 bonus (total bankroll A$300), you can expect to lose approximately A$90, leaving you with A$210. Your net cash after wagering would be the original deposit minus the loss: A$150 – A$90 = A$60 (if you stop exactly after meeting the wagering). However, bonus funds are often used first, so actual mathematics can vary. Always check the terms for the order of funds.
Step 5 – Calculate the bonus real value.
Bonus Real Value = Bonus – (Wagering Requirement × House Edge) = A$150 – (A$3,000 × 0.03) = A$150 – A$90 = A$60. So the bonus is worth about A$60 in real expected cash.
